Output e5b93fdd7fbf72e45ff5aee89de0e2aab65321b290d6bce22a1d5a609f016fbd:1

value
4344635
script pubkey
OP_0 OP_PUSHBYTES_32 83b40a4b011ca177c0caf27f70bfc56c1587aaf011cd19ca52a1909f50a6324d
address
bc1qsw6q5jcprjsh0sx27flhp079ds2c02hsz8x3njjj5xgf759xxfxs4hcuzy
transaction
e5b93fdd7fbf72e45ff5aee89de0e2aab65321b290d6bce22a1d5a609f016fbd
confirmations
33897
spent
true